cve-2020-8607
Vulnerability from cvelistv5
Published
2020-08-05 14:05
Modified
2024-08-04 10:03
Severity ?
Summary
An input validation vulnerability found in multiple Trend Micro products utilizing a particular version of a specific rootkit protection driver could allow an attacker in user-mode with administrator permissions to abuse the driver to modify a kernel address that may cause a system crash or potentially lead to code execution in kernel mode. An attacker must already have obtained administrator access on the target machine (either legitimately or via a separate unrelated attack) to exploit this vulnerability.

cve-2022-26319
Vulnerability from cvelistv5
Published
2022-03-08 21:55
Modified
2024-08-03 05:03
Severity ?
Summary
An installer search patch element vulnerability in Trend Micro Portable Security 3.0 Pro, 3.0 and 2.0 could allow a local attacker to place an arbitrarily generated DLL file in an installer folder to elevate local privileges. Please note: an attacker must first obtain the ability to execute high-privileged code on the target system in order to exploit this vulnerability.
